Field Hockey Crushes Framingham State On Senior Day

KEENE, N.H.--The Keene State College field hockey team sent the class of 2016 out with a bang, with an 11-3 rout of Framingham State University on Senior Day at Owl Athletic Complex.

Keene State finishes the regular season at 13-7, and 9-2 in the LEC.  The Owls will be the No. 3 seed in the LEC tournament and host Bridgewater State University in a quarterfinal matchup on November 3 at 6 p.m. 

The Rams end the season at 4-14, and 2-9 in LEC play.

Sami Smith had three goals and an assist, her third hat-trick of the season.  Julia Babbitt scored twice, while Erica Stauffer, Mia Brickley, Haylie Dolan, Brittany Johnson, Marita Brothers, and Kayla Renaud each scored once.

Dolan, Johnson, Sami Smith, and Brittney Cardente each had an assist.  All four KSC goalkeepers saw time; Meaghan Dwyer started and did not make a save in 17:29 in the cage.  Gwendolyn Thayer played 24 minutes and made two saves, as did Nicole DiFilippo in 18 minutes of work, and Kendra Lonergan did not make a save in 11 minutes of action.  

Keene State scored twice in the first eight minutes of the game, as Sami Smith got both goals.  Renaud, Brothers, and Babbitt all scored in the first half to send KSC into the lockerroom up 5-0.

Smith completed the hat-trick and Dolan scored to make it 7-0 before the Rams brokeup the shuout on Meaghann Ackerman's penalty stroke.  

Johnson, Stauffer, Babbitt and Brickley all scored before the Rams tacked on two more in the final seven minutes.

Before the game, seniors Dolan, Dwyer, and Emily Medeiros were honored for their contributions to the program.
